It is extraordinary that there has been a deafening silence. Those who are defending this approach are largely conscripts and people who have vested interests in the system. We need an objective debate on this. Let us not forget that these are decisions where the interests of taxpayers and the interests of investors in banks are pitted against one another. We have to make decisions that are based on proper understanding of those considerations. Taking the approach that it is five minutes to midnight, that we must get something through and we have been waiting too long to act, is not the way to make this decision. That would be a serious mistake.
